Appendix 1.1 Cable Wire and Assembly

(1) Cable wire
The specifications of the wire used for each cable, and the machining methods are shown in this section. When
manufacturing the detector cable and battery connection cable, use the recommended wires shown below or equivalent
products.

(Note 1) Bando Electric Wire (Contact: +81-48-461-0561 http://www.bew.co.jp)
(Note 2) The Mitsubishi standard cable is the (a) Heat resistant specifications cable. For MDS-C1/CH series, (b) or
equivalent is used as the standard cable.
